BUILDING work is under way at the £11m care facility on the site of a former Grappenhall pub.

The build is taking place on the former Springbrook pub, off Knutsford Road, and a practical completion date has been set for March 2023.

Remediation works started at the end of 2021 which included the demolition of the existing pub.

And over the last few weeks work has gathered pace.

The sheet piles, foundations, some brickwork and a ground floor are all in place and scaffolding has been erected ready for the installation of the metal frame this month.

New Care’s 70-bed development features fully-furnished en-suite bedrooms, communal lounges and dining rooms, spa-assisted bathrooms, a hair salon, nail bar and landscaped front and rear gardens.

When complete, it will provide a clinical offering focusing on residential, nursing and dementia care. 

Commissioning director at New Care, Dawn Collett, said: “Work in Grappenhall is going really well, the foundations are in and brickwork has commenced meaning that locals will soon start to see the building appear above the hoarding. 

“Over the course of the next 12 months the building will really start to take shape and we look forward to welcoming our first residents to their beautiful new home in March 2023.”
